New Zealand Scholarship - for Pacific, Asian, African, Caribbean and Latin American Countries
Study level
Undergraduate,Postgraduate
Eligibility requirements
Funded by the New Zealand Government through the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Trade (MFAT), a New Zealand Scholarship offers eligible candidates the opportunity to gain knowledge and skills through study that will assist in the development of their home countries. Awardees are required to return to their home country for at least 2 years after the completion of their scholarship to apply these new skills and knowledge in government, civil society, or private business organisations. Applications for a New Zealand Scholarship are available for the following qualifications:
- Undergraduate Degree (3 – 4 years)
- Postgraduate Certificate (6 months)
- Postgraduate Diploma (1 year)
- Master’s Degree (1 – 2 years)
- PhD (3 – 4 years)
What does it cover?
- Full tuition fees
- Return economy air travel
- An establishment allowance upon arrival in New Zealand
- Medical insurance
- Provision for students to meet basic living costs
- The partners of students may be eligible for a work visa that allows them to live and work in New Zealand for the duration of their partner’s study.

Commonwealth Scholarships
Study level
Postgraduate
Eligibility requirements
This scholarship is offered to students from other parts of the Commonwealth under the commonwealth scholarship and fellowship plan. The scholarships aim to provide opportunities for students to pursue advanced courses or undertake research at a university in New Zealand. Candidates must be commonwealth citizens or British protected persons and have graduated from an institution in their own country.

Massey University Creative Arts International Excellence Scholarships
Study level
Undergraduate
Eligibility requirements
This is open to students who have demonstrated academic excellence in Creative Arts subjects while studying in New Zealand or abroad for the following programmes:
- Bachelor of Design (Hons);
- Bachelor of Fine Arts (Hons);
- Bachelor of Maori Visual Arts;
- Bachelor of Creative Media Production; and
- Bachelor of Commercial Music
Application details
Application deadline: 1 December for February entry and 1 May for July entry. For further information, please contact the university website.
Value details
Each Scholarship is valued at NZ $20,000 for a 4-year degree or NZ $15,000 for a 3-year degree
